It's been available (again) for a couple of years or more. What happened is that when Vistana/II bought out Starwood, they decided to charge for guest confirmations for some reservations, so for several months you had to call in to get a guest confirmation. Then, once that was established, they went back to the online guest confirmation request, and continued to charge a fee for a totally automated service. In other words, a money grab.

They actually did! - but the original ownership terms and conditions say that the management company CANNOT charge owners for guest confirmations for home resort reservations. So Vistana had to back down, because they got so many complaints from owners - this protest was led by Tuggers. I have to say that it was pretty stupid for them to change the terms, without even checking to see if they could get away with it!

Yeah, the ability to change names has been available for a while. I also notice that you can change the name to someone you sell a contract to for no fee. I sold a contract a couple of years ago and noticed that one of the options to add a guest certificate/name to was the person I sold that contract to. No fee. I guess this would be helpful if you provide usage for a year but the reservation still remains in your account.
 
so as to not start a new thread, I booked a reservation for tomorrow (July 4th) for a friend with some banked SOs. I paid the $59 name change fee. Her daughter is sick and they need to cancel. I know I have to pay $75 to cancel and get the banked SOs back and that they are only good for 60 days, but will I have to pay the name change fee again if I book it for another date in July/August?
 
Yes - because it will be a completely different reservation/date/confirmation number. If you only changed the name, there would be no fee.
